Kateřina Skypalová gained her first experience in competitions, international level, at the European Youth Olympic Festival 2015 in the Georgian capital Tbilisi . There she was eliminated from the qualification with 52.81 m. A year later, she won the gold medal there with 66.58 m at the U18 European Championships, which were held for the first time . In 2017 she took part in the U20 European Championships in Grosseto , where she also won gold with 64.78 meters. In 2018 she took part in the U20 World Championships in Tampere , where she finished seventh with 61.37 m in the final.
In 2017 Skypalová became the Czech hammer throw champion.
